Understanding Credit Card Processing: A Beginner's Guide

Credit payment processing might appear intricate, but it’s actually a relatively straightforward procedure. Essentially, when you complete a purchase using your charge card, information is transmitted from the merchant's checkout system to the acquiring bank. This financial institution then sends the details to the card network – like copyright or Mastercard - which routes it to the issuing bank, representing the consumer’s bank. The issuer authorizes the transaction based on available funds and other factors, sending a response back through the same route. Finally, the merchant's bank website settles the payment, minus any applicable fees, completing the entire cycle. Understanding this basic flow can help both businesses and consumers better grasp how electronic payments truly work. Navigating the World of Credit Card Processing Fees Understanding the intricate landscape concerning credit card processing costs can feel like a overwhelming hurdle . Merchants often encounter various sorts of assessments, including interchange prices , assessment levies , and processor premiums. These expenses are generally calculated as an percentage from each sale , plus the small per- unit fee. Learning how these components work is crucial for improving your business’s profitability and preventing unexpected financial setbacks . Secure and Reliable Credit Card Processing Solutions Explained Navigating the world of payment processing can be confusing , especially when it comes to safety . Businesses need trustworthy solutions that safeguard both their clients’ sensitive information and their own business well-being. These platforms go beyond simply accepting payments ; they involve a series of protocols to ensure compliance with industry standards like PCI DSS, encrypting data during transmission and storage, and preventing fraudulent activity. Finding the right provider is crucial; look for features such as tokenization, EMV support, fraud detection tools, and dependable uptime to guarantee a seamless experience for everyone involved and minimize potential liabilities .
